TB bacteria use iron to survive

the tuberculosis (tb) bacteria kill two people every three minutes. The bacteria uses iron from the human body to survive. But the mechanism by which they source the iron was not known. Researchers from the University of Hyderabad have recently cracked the mechanism. Their research paves the way for new medicines to treat the disease better.

The tb pathogen sources its iron through molecules called siderophores, which have high affinity for iron. First, the pathogens release these molecules, which extracts iron from human cells, leaving them iron-scarce. The molecules are then transported back to the pathogen, which synthesizes the iron to sustain and grow at the cost of the host. These actions are dependent on two proteins that help complete the transportation cycle of siderophores. Blocking this transportation through medicines can be a breakthrough to cure tb. First, it will stop the iron uptake and secretion. Since there will be no export pathway for siderophores, it will extract iron from the microbe itself.
